地方小剧种亮相国际大舞台
Ren Min Ri Bao· 2025-06-04 21:56
Group 1 - The Zhejiang Wuju Art Research Institute has successfully performed in 69 countries and regions, attracting over 5 million audience members, showcasing its cultural export achievements [1] - The Wuju opera "Legend of the White Snake" was a highlight of the "2025 China Opera Performance Season and International Exhibition" held in Vienna, receiving enthusiastic applause from local audiences [1] - Wuju opera, originating from Jinhua, Zhejiang, is recognized as a national intangible cultural heritage, and its unique characteristics contribute to its international appeal [1] Group 2 - The journey of Wuju opera's international performances faced challenges, such as high transportation costs for traditional props, prompting the need for innovation in stage equipment [2] - The current performances utilize foldable aluminum props, allowing for easier transport, and the cast members are trained to perform multiple roles to adapt to international touring requirements [2] - To cater to overseas audiences, the Zhejiang Wuju Art Research Institute has incorporated innovative elements into performances, such as advanced stage techniques and real-time translations of lyrics in local languages [2] Group 3 - The director of the Zhejiang Wuju Art Research Institute emphasizes that cultural export is a long-term and challenging task, requiring deeper collaboration with local partners for effective communication and understanding [3]

《智取威虎山》拉开梅花奖终评大幕
Jie Fang Ri Bao· 2025-05-09 01:31
Core Points - The 10th China Drama Award and the 32nd Plum Blossom Award are being held in Shanghai, featuring performances from 17 actors across various theatrical genres [1] - The awards emphasize a return to the essence of drama, prioritizing performances that adhere to the aesthetic of traditional Chinese opera while maintaining low production costs [2] - This year marks the first time that private theater troupes can apply for the Plum Blossom Award, broadening the scope of participation [2] Group 1 - The final evaluation of the Plum Blossom Award includes 62 outstanding drama actors, with 17 selected for the final round [1] - The opening performance of the final evaluation was "Taking Tiger Mountain by Strategy," which received enthusiastic applause from the audience [1] - The event is co-hosted by the China Federation of Literary and Art Circles, the China Theatre Association, and the Shanghai Municipal Committee of the Communist Party of China [1] Group 2 - The awards encourage participation from actors in less represented regions and genres, such as the Xinjiang Uygur Autonomous Region [2] - Award-winning actors will perform outreach shows in grassroots communities following the announcement of the winners [3]
